HANDOVER NOTE

From: Dario Venn, outgoing Commercial Director
To: Priya Skalde, incoming

Priya — quick flag on discounting for large deals before you take the chair. Anything over the Kestrel threshold currently needs dual sign-off, and the board wants that kept tight. A couple of regional leads have been pushing for exceptions; hold the line until the review lands. The thinking behind the policy is captured just below.

internal memo for kawip-hadug: Headcount on the Wenwyn team goes from 7 to 140 by the end of January. Gross margin on Wenwyn came in at 20 percent against a plan of 15 percent.

## Tuning

Bulk edits in the Cardstock admin table are chunked to keep lock times short. Larger chunks reduce round trips but risk timeouts on wide rows; the defaults were chosen after the Penhallow migration. Adjust conservatively and watch the queue depth dashboard. Current defaults follow, as discussed at last week's sync.

constants for tageg-kagag:
QUOTAS = {
    "kelax": 495,
    "istath": 366,
    "tammir": 108,
    "novdor": 730,
    "casax": 816,
    "quenael": 874,
    "pelius": 403,
}

Subject: Quickstore 4.2 — bloom filter now fronts the KV layer

Plugin authors: starting with this release, Quickstore places a bloom filter ahead of the key-value store. Negative lookups return faster; false positives fall through safely. No API changes are required on your side. Verify your plugin against the staging build referenced below.

session token of fahif-tadup = htk3_9c7

## Ownership

Heads up, support folks: the Murmur service is famously chatty, so we sample its logs at 2% by default. If a customer issue needs full-fidelity logs, sampling can be bumped temporarily via the Quietside config — but please don't leave it cranked up, or storage costs balloon fast. For sampling changes, escalations, or anything weird in the Murmur log pipeline, the owner to contact is listed below.

named custodian: Brivan Eliath Quenox Frador